Early Diagnosis Prevents Long Term Damage

Hip pain can result from various causes, including arthritis, bursitis, tendonitis, muscle strain, or even structural issues like hip dysplasia. In some cases, it may indicate a more serious condition, such as a labral tear or a fracture. Ignoring hip pain allows these issues to progress, potentially leading to permanent damage or more invasive treatment down the line. An orthopaedic specialist can assess your symptoms, perform diagnostic tests, and identify the root cause of your discomfort, enabling timely intervention.

Avoid Chronic Pain and Mobility Issues

Unchecked hip pain can lead to compensatory movements, where your body shifts pressure away from the affected hip. This compensation may relieve short-term discomfort but can strain other joints, muscles, and ligaments, causing additional pain or injuries. Over time, untreated hip conditions can lead to chronic pain, stiffness, and even difficulty walking. Early treatment by a specialist can prevent these complications, preserving your mobility and quality of life.

Modern Treatments Offer Effective Relief

Orthopaedic specialists are experts in treating hip pain. Depending on the diagnosis, treatment options can range from physical therapy, anti-inflammatory medications and/or injections. In severe cases, hip replacement surgery may be necessary, but addressing the issue early often avoids the need for such interventions.

Prolonged Pain Can Affect Mental Health

Living with persistent hip pain can take a toll on your mental health, leading to anxiety, depression, or frustration due to reduced activity levels and chronic discomfort. Seeking timely care from a specialist can help you regain control of your life, reduce pain, and improve your emotional well-being.
